Weekend and holiday coverage
Saturday standard. Sunday and stat holidays are emergency-only with a documented callout fee that's waived if we book the follow-up job.
How we prioritise
Active leaks, gas smell, and animal-in-flue jump the queue over cosmetic animal removal work. We text realistic ETAs, not "we'll get to it."
Response windows across Orangeville
Standard bookings inside Orangeville: 3–5 business days. Same-day: usually before 2pm if we get the call by 9am. Emergency (water in flue, active leak): 90 minutes on weekdays, 3 hours weekends.

Do you need a permit for animal removal in Orangeville?
Cleaning and inspection are permit-exempt in Orangeville. Structural masonry, liner replacement, or a new appliance install typically need one — we pull it as part of the job when required.

Is animal removal covered by home insurance in Orangeville?
Sudden damage (storm, animal, appliance failure) is usually covered minus deductible. Gradual wear generally isn't. A written pro assessment before the claim call materially improves outcomes.
